Jdu Mla Sanjeev Singh's big statement about reviewing Bihar's voters list said: "Serious problems happening about Sir"

The review of the voters list in Bihar is going on hard, but opposition parties raised questions about it. On this issue, the party Nitish Kumar’s Party Janata Dal United (JDU) Mla Sanjeev Singh also spoke openly. Sanjeev Singh said in a conversation with the media on Wednesday, July 23, 2025: “The voter list review process is in the right direction, but there are many problems at the local level about the ‘Sir’ (special information report), needed.” He said that information from many districts was received that confusion arises when the removal or addition of the names of voters based on Sir. As a result, dissatisfaction is increasing in rural areas. Advice to officials Sanjeev Singh said he spoke to the state election office in this regard and requested officials that – “Whatever procedures are adopted, they should be transparent and simplified. No voter law should be violated.” What made the allegations through the opposition parties, Sheev Singh said “rumors are being distributed for political profits.” He assured that the JDU and NDA government was committed to incorporating the names of each legal voter into the list.
